Landscape grading and resloping involve reshaping the surface to enhance drainage, prevent disintegration, and develop visually appealing outside areas. Correct grading directs water far from structures, minimizes pooling, and supports healthy plant growth. The process begins with examining the existing topography, soil type, and desired water circulation. Heavy machinery or hand grading might be used to adjust slopes, level areas for lawns, and develop functional areas such as terraces or pathways. Resloping also supports long-term landscape health by preventing soil erosion, lowering stress on plants, and maintaining proper drainage. Well-executed grading ensures structural stability, boosts visual appeal, and safeguards the property from water-related damage
